Portrait of Hirak Doshi

Hirak Doshi, Ph.D.

Applied Mathematics·Vision & Motion Estimation·Computational Neuroscience

I am an applied mathematician and computational researcher interested in understanding and solving problems in imaging. My work spans mathematical image processing, motion estimation, computer vision, computational neuroscience, and medical imaging, with a particular focus on diffusion MRI.

I am interested in developing computational methods that bring together mathematical modeling, variational and PDE-based approaches, and deep learning. Welcome to my website — I hope you enjoy exploring my research, teaching, projects, and some of the other things I work on.
